We'll have a fossil from, for example, … WebDarwin's 'Theory of Evolution' is a slow gradual process. Darwin wrote, "Natural selection acts only by taking advantage of slight successive variations. It can never take a great and sudden leap, but must advance by short and sure, though slow steps". So, according to Darwin, evolution is a slow, gradual and continuous process. See more In biology, evolution is the change in heritable characteristics of biological populations over successive generations. These characteristics are the expressions of genes, which are passed on from parent to offspring during See more Evolution can occur if there is genetic variation within a population. Variation comes from mutations in the genome, reshuffling of genes through sexual reproduction and migration between populations (gene flow).
